Home to the University of Iowa, the Iowa City area

has become the epitome of progress, technological

advancement and development while enhancing its

character of supreme livability. The area’s eclectic

charm, its pastoral surroundings and reputation as

a mecca for the arts and culture, have made our

communities a destination for those seeking creative

exploration and expression. Our high quality of

life is reflected in our jobs, our schools, our steady

population growth, a reasonable cost of living and

our friendly neighborhoods.

• TotalenrollmentattheUniversityofIowawas30,409 for the first semester of the 07–08 academic year; 9.3% of which were minority students.

• TheUniversitycollected$382.2 million in external funding for research, education, and service in Fy06 and has a budget of $2.285 billion for revenues and expenses for Fy07.

• IowaCityCommunitySchoolshavethe4th-highest college board scores and graduation rates in the nation. — expansion Management magazine.

• KirkwoodCommunityCollegeisno. 28 (among 1,200 community colleges) in the nation in total number of degrees conferred. — Community College Week.
